UCL Cancer Institute (UCL CI) is a state-of-the-art institute to consolidate cancer research at UCL and promote links with our partner teaching hospitals, in order to support excellence in basic and translational studies. The Institute draws together talented scientists who are working together to translate research discoveries into developing kinder, more effective therapies for cancer patients. It is a Cancer Research UK and Experimental Cancer Medicine Centre, and contains approximately 580 staff, including 120 PhD and MD (Res) students and 40 MSc students.

About the role

The STAMPEDE trial (www.stampedetrial.org) was the first multi-arm multi-stage platform trial to open (in 2004) and to date has contributed to several large-scale changes in the management of patients with advanced prostate cancer. Over the past few years we have used molecular tests for biomarker-based stratification and for interrogating disease biology that underlies treatment resistance. STAMPEDE2 was initiated in 2023 and builds on STAMPEDE1, to further improve the outcomes of metastatic patients. The trials are conducted by the Innovative CTU at UCL working closely with the Trial Management Group. STAMPEDE2 is randomly allocating patients with high volume metastatic prostate cancer (N=1500) to the radioligand therapy 177Lu-PSMA-617. Patients who consent to STAMPEDE-Life will donate plasma at every point of disease progression and have the option to participate in the post-mortem study (PEACE, Posthumous Evaluation of Advanced Cancer Environment). In this programme, recently funded by Prostate Cancer UK, we will track resistant clones after treatment and define mechanisms of resistance to radioligand therapy and how early use of treatment impacts the evolution to treatment-resistant disease. The team will also work closely with scientists studying biopsies of residual disease obtained after radioligand therapy.

The programme aims to integrate molecular pathology with detailed genomic and clinical datasets across different tumour types, in order to map the dynamics of the TME from early to late stage disease and in response to therapies. The Treatment Resistance Team led by Professor Gerhardt Attard is a multi-disciplinary team focusing on studying treatment resistance in advanced urological cancers. The group has been integrating solid tumour and circulating cell-free DNA genomics, transcriptomics and epigenomics with functional studies to track tumour clone dynamics in patients progressing through multiple lines of treatment. The aim is to identify cancer vulnerabilities to be exploited therapeutically and design clinical trials of biomarker-directed strategies for rational treatment selection and sequencing.
